Como ver o código-fonte do GSP que virou um fonte groovy!!
15/04/2008 00:00
0
Pessoal,

Essa eu achei muito útil mesmo. Como sabemos, um jsp quando é compilado pelo container, se transforma automaticamente em um .java! Não poderia ser diferente, e é claro, que um .gsp também tem que virar código-fonte, e não por menos, ele vira um .groovy.

E qual a utilidade de se ver o código-fonte que foi gerado? Bom, espere só até receber uma exception assim:



Complicado né! Então, basta passar o parâmetro abaixo, no fim da url.

?showSource


Fazendo com que a url fique:

http://host:port/grails-app/controller/action/id?showSource


Exatamente, e você vai conseguir ver o código que foi gerado, e enfim, entender o que é que aconteceu na linha descrita na exception!



Muito útil mesmo! Mas atenção, este parâmetro só funciona em ambiente de desenvolvimento, e não em amb. de test ou prod!

Um abraço!


Fonte: Viewing the source of a compiled GSP in Grails
Tags: Snippets


Ainda não faz parte da comunidade???

Para se registrar, clique aqui.


Aprenda Groovy e Grails com a Formação itexto!

Newsletter Semana Groovy

Assinar

Envie seu link!


Livro de Grails


/dev/All

Os melhores blogs de TI (e em português) em um único lugar!

 
Creative Commons
RSS Grails Brasil é mantido por itexto Consultoria.
Em caso de problemas contacte Henrique Lobo Weissmann (Kico) por e-mail: kico@itexto.com.br
Todo o conteúdo presente neste site adota o Creative Commons como licença padrão.
Ver: 4.14.0
itexto